Join CareATC presenters Sarah Peele and Gabe Kramer for a look at how CareATC’s nationwide employer clinic model is expanding impact beyond primary care through Food as Medicine. Learn how CareATC partners with employers and local farms/Community Supported Agricultures to pair dietitian-led nutrition coaching with hands-on food access. This real-world model supports high-risk populations with a 12-week program that combines weekly produce bags, dietitian-approved recipes and education, and hands-on cooking demonstrations, making healthy eating practical, affordable, and sustainable. We’ll also share how CareATC measures impact through pre/post labs and vitals and what employers are seeing: improvements in A1c, LDL cholesterol, blood pressure, weight, and participant confidence.
